By: Eric Giguere | 2010-11-25 | Environmental A huge white shark appeared grinning at the camera of BBC Wildlife Photographers while it was swimming near the coast of Guadalupe Island, Mexico. Divers swam in and out of cages 40ft under the water with the aim of taking photos of the 14 feet long shark. These great whites are known as the most dangerous predators on Earth. They have offered brave divers the chance to get up close and personal with them. The sharks were discovered last month when they migrated to feed on elephant bull seals that gathered on Guadalupe. By: Mary Rose | 2011-01-18 | Environment If someone is keen on ocean discovery and experiencing such marvelous marine adventures , their biggest fear may be shark attacks. According to the statistics from the Florida Museum of natural history and National Geographic, sharks, known as apex predators under the sea, cause 10 deaths each years. These are the results from annually 75 unprovoked shark attacks all over the world.
